Sure, here are seven interesting facts about the human tongue:
1. **Taste Buds Variety**:
The human tongue has about 5,000 to 10,000 taste buds, which are specialized for detecting five basic tastes: sweet, sour, salty, bitter, and umami (savory).
2. **Unique Patterns**:
Just like fingerprints, each person's tongue has a unique pattern of ridges and bumps, which can be used for identification in some contexts.
3. **Muscle Composition**:
The tongue is made up of eight muscles, which work together to allow for a wide range of movements, from speaking to chewing to swallowing.
4. **Self-Cleaning**:
The tongue has natural antibacterial properties and a self-cleaning mechanism that helps reduce bacterial buildup and maintain oral hygiene.
5. **Sensory Functions**:
Beyond taste, the tongue is also involved in the sensory experience of food, helping to detect texture, temperature, and even pain.
6. **Language and Speech**:
The tongue plays a crucial role in forming various speech sounds, helping to articulate consonants and vowels essential for clear communication.
7. **Color Indicator**:
The color of the tongue can be an indicator of overall health; for example, a pale or coated tongue might suggest a deficiency or an underlying health issue, while a healthy tongue is typically pink and moist.
